Abstract
It has been established by Bao, Lin and Sontag (2000) that, for neutrally stable discrete-time linear systems subject to actuator saturation, finite gain lp stabilization can be achieved by linear output feedback, for every p ∈ (1, ∞] except p = 1. An explicit construction of the corresponding feedback laws was given. The feedback laws constructed also resulted in a closed-loop system that is globally asymptotically stable. This note complements the results of Bao, Lin and Sontag (2000) by showing that they also hold for the case of p = 1.
